A rare original Christmas 1900 Tin 'Presented To The Scottish Soldiers In South Africa By The Scottish Regiment Gift Fund'. Attractive yellow tin bearing large coloured central thistle, 'Lion Rampant of Scotland' inscribed 'Frae Scots tae Scots' 'South Africa 1900' and 'For Auld Lang Syne'; accompanied by an official Presentation Card from the Gift Fund, also a hand written note in pencil 'A present from South Africa Christmas 1900 Wishing you all a very merry Chrismas & happy New Year' the reverse signed 'Tom Gerrard Scots Guards'. Good condition. Size 101 x 84mm. Attributed to 2012 Private Thomas Gerrard who served with the 1st and 3rd Battalions of the Scots Guards during the Boer War. He was awarded the Queen's South Africa Medal with the clasps Belmont, Modder River and Driefontein.
